  • I’ve set up my site as Multisite, but I’d like the sites that I create to be within a sub-domain.

    The site domain is:

    indie-film.tv

    I have various other things going on there, such as blog posts, pages, BuddyPress, etc, so I’d like all of the craeted sites to be at this URL:

    indie-film.tv/sites/name-of-site

    Is this possible?

    Subdomains are in the format of subdomain.domain.com

    So yours would be, say, bollywood.indie-film.tv

    If you want your sites to be indie-film.tv/sites/name-of-site then you would be using subfolders and install WP in the /sites/ folder.

    Yeah, my brain stopped for a minute there. The installation is sub-folders.

    I was hoping to install it on the main domain, as then I could pull info from various sites into the main site, is that not possible?

    Multisite doesn’t like it when it’s not using the URL of the folder it’s running out of. It’s particular that way.

    If you install in the main domain, your sites would be indie-film.tv/name-of-site

    Now, you can go in and edit the site to force /site/ in there, but I don’t know what that’d do…
